Rebecca Hennessy's Singer-Songwriter Circle feat. Felicity Williams, Patrick O'Reilly & Michael Herring

"Hosted by trumpeter, vocalist, keyboardist, and songwriter Rebecca Hennessy, the Tranzac Singer-Songwriter Circle is an intimate songs-in-the-round series celebrating original music, storytelling, and spontaneous collaboration. This month's featured guest is Felicity Williams, one of Toronto's most distinctive and adventurous musical voices. A singer and songwriter whose work moves seamlessly between jazz, folk, improvisation, and experimental music, Williams has collaborated with many of the city's celebrated artists, including Robin Dann, Alex Lukashevsky, Luka Kuplowsky, Ben Gunning, Isis Giraldo, Thomas Gill, Christine Bougie, Carlyn Bezic, and Alex Samaras. She is one half of You Can Can with sound and visual artist Andrew Zukerman and is also a member of the touring band for Bahamas. Joining her for the evening is guitarist Patrick O'Reilly, an expressive and versatile musician whose thoughtful, lyrical playing brings warmth and depth to every performance. Throughout the evening, Rebecca Hennessy will share a selection of original songs while performing on vocals, trumpet, and keyboard. She is joined by acclaimed bassist Michael Herring, whose strong musical voice, deep listening, and years of collaboration with artists across Canada provide the perfect foundation for an evening of musical exploration. Rather than a traditional concert, the Singer-Songwriter Circle invites audiences into a relaxed and engaging musical conversation, where songs are shared, stories unfold, and collaborations emerge naturally. Each performance is unique, offering listeners a rare opportunity to experience four exceptional musicians connecting through original music in an intimate setting. "
